Exploring Australia’s Natural Beauty for Your Skin and Hair


Australia’s unique environment provides a treasure trove of natural ingredients that are perfect for beauty care. I love how many local brands harness these gifts to create products that are gentle, effective, and sustainable.


Here are some standout ingredients and their benefits:


  • Kakadu Plum: Packed with vitamin C, it brightens skin and fights free radicals.

  • Macadamia Oil: Rich in fatty acids, it deeply moisturises and softens hair.

  • Lemon Myrtle: Known for its antibacterial properties, it helps keep skin clear.

  • Wattle Seed: Contains antioxidants that protect and rejuvenate skin.


Using products with these ingredients means you’re treating your body to nature’s best. Plus, many of these plants are native to Australia, so supporting these products helps preserve local ecosystems and indigenous knowledge.

What is the Australian Slang for Beauty?


Australia has a fun and colourful way of expressing just about everything, including beauty. If you’re curious about how Aussies talk about looking good, here are some common slang terms you might hear:


  • “Beaut” - Short for beautiful or great. For example, “That’s a beaut outfit!”

  • “Bonza” - Means excellent or first-rate. “You’re looking bonza today!”

  • “Ace” - Another way to say something is top-notch or impressive.

  • “Ripper” - Used to describe something fantastic or awesome.


These words reflect the laid-back, friendly Aussie spirit. When it comes to beauty, Aussies appreciate natural charm and confidence over anything too flashy or artificial. It’s all about being comfortable in your own skin and enjoying life.


How to Start Your Own Holistic Natural Beauty Routine


If you’re ready to embrace holistic natural beauty, here are some simple steps to get started:


  1. Assess your current products: Look at the ingredients list and avoid harsh chemicals like parabens, sulfates, and synthetic fragrances.

  2. Choose certified organic or natural brands: Look for certifications like Australian Certified Organic or EcoCert.

  3. Incorporate native ingredients: Try products with Australian botanicals for a unique and effective experience.

  4. Simplify your routine: Focus on quality over quantity. A gentle cleanser, a nourishing moisturizer, and a natural sunscreen can go a long way.

  5. Practice self-care: Take time for rituals like facial massages, hair masks, or mindful breathing to enhance your overall well-being.

  6. Support sustainable packaging: Opt for brands that use recyclable or biodegradable materials.


Remember, the goal is progress, not perfection. Every small change you make contributes to a healthier you and a healthier planet.
